Xiaofei Shi is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Mechanical Engineering. According to data from OpenAlex, Xiaofei Shi has authored 69 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Materials Chemistry, 16 papers in Electrical and Electronic Engineering and 12 papers in Mechanical Engineering. Recurrent topics in Xiaofei Shi’s work include Luminescence Properties of Advanced Materials (12 papers), Perovskite Materials and Applications (5 papers) and Advanced ceramic materials synthesis (5 papers). Xiaofei Shi is often cited by papers focused on Luminescence Properties of Advanced Materials (12 papers), Perovskite Materials and Applications (5 papers) and Advanced ceramic materials synthesis (5 papers). Xiaofei Shi collaborates with scholars based in China, Japan and United States. Xiaofei Shi's co-authors include Qinyuan Jiang, Rufan Zhang, Ying Han, Haibing Meng, Chenhui Zhou, Chenhao Zhan, Yu Qian, Siyu Yang, Ji‐Guang Li and Qi Zhu and has published in prestigious journals such as Advanced Materials, Nano Letters and Advanced Functional Materials.
